At least 4000 Igbo traders in Kano rendered 'shopless' by Sabon Gari fire. 90% of market destroyed. Billions lost

There is wailing and gnashing of teeth especially among 'Igbos of Northern Nigeria' as midnight fire razed over 4,000 shops at the popular Sabon Gari market in Kano, dominated by Igbo traders. The fire is reported to have destroyed 90% of the market and property worth billions of naira.

One dead as highly-exploited Igbo traders clash with Yoruba touts in Ladipo Market Lagos State
One person was confirmed dead as highly-exploited Igbo traders at the Ladipo Market in the Oshodi area of Lagos, on Thursday protested against continuous extortion by touts under the command of the Lagos State government. Monday Ijoba is alleged to be the head of the touts who continually harass the Igbo traders.
